TRAISIM

The objective of this project is to build a power system training Digital Twin that could be used to train future operators. This training Digital Twin will be partly developed by the European project TWINEU (Pilot 8, covered by Task 5.5 - A power system training simulator for complex and critical situations) and be enhanced by this side project called TRAISIM. TRAISIM focuses on the acceleration of the real-time simulator embedded in the training simulator, where the simulation must operate at least as fast as the actual physical processes it replicates.

D-GITT

D-GITT (Detailed Grid Inner Topology Timeseries) is about giving access to node-breaker description timeseries of power grids, starting with 6-month history at 5' intervals for the French transmission grid. This experimentation shall be part of the LF Energy project OpenSynth.

Dynawo

Dynaωo is an hybrid C++/Modelica complete and coherent open source suite of simulation tools for power systems, aiming at ease collaboration and cooperation in the power system community.

DP Sim

DPsim is a real-time capable power system simulator that supports dynamic phasor and electromagnetic transient simulation as well as continuous powerflow. It primarily targets large-scale scenarios on commercial off-the-sheld hardware that require deterministic time steps in the range of micro- to milliseconds.

SSST – Small Signal Stability Toolbox

The Small Signal Stability Toolbox (SSST) is a collection of Matlab functions for the analysis and control of small signal stability of power systems: load flow solution, output of load flow solution, linear model, eigenvalue analysis, output of the eigenvalue analysis, linear responses, reduced order eigenvalue analysis, sensitivities with respect to FACTS devices modulation, design of a single damping controller and coordinated design of multiple damping controllers.
